Main Management

Thekla Neokleous

IT Officer

Thekla Neokleous has obtained her bachelor from Frederick University Cyprus with specialization in Graphic and Advertising Design. She has excellent knowledge in computer programmes and softwares and she is responsible for the smooth operation of the company’s IT systems. Her tasks also include the continuous update of the electronic information services and she covers as well the technical part of the dissemination and information campaigns where TALOS takes part.